Meta to Cut 8,000 Jobs in Major Workforce Reduction on May 20

Meta Platforms Inc. is preparing to implement significant workforce reductions, targeting approximately 8,000 employees in a massive layoff initiative. The company has set the date for these layoffs on May 20, marking a substantial change in its workforce strategy.

Details of the Layoff Announcement

According to multiple reports, this reduction will affect about 10% of Meta’s workforce. The decision aligns with the company’s ongoing efforts to streamline operations and adapt to evolving market conditions.

Implications for Employees

These layoffs are part of a broader trend in the tech industry, where many companies are making similar cuts. Meta’s move reflects increasing pressure to optimize productivity and enhance operational efficiency.

Future Outlook

Meta has indicated that additional layoffs may follow in 2026. This suggests a long-term strategy to reassess workforce needs amid its AI development initiatives.
